While official heat alerts are necessary for immediate safety, they often mask a deeper, more systemic failure to adapt urban environments to the realities of the Anthropocene. The recurring heatwaves of 2026 have exposed the vulnerability of French cities, which were largely designed for a temperate climate that no longer exists. Zinc roofs, dense concrete, and a lack of green space create 'urban heat islands' that trap heat, turning homes and public transport into ovens. Simply telling citizens to drink water and stay indoors is a short-term fix that ignores the urgent need for structural urban transformation.
There is a growing concern that the current policy focus on individual responsibility—telling people to avoid the sun—deflects from the lack of investment in climate-resilient infrastructure. Retrofitting historic buildings to improve insulation, expanding urban forests to provide natural cooling, and redesigning public spaces to reduce heat absorption are expensive but necessary steps that have been delayed for too long. Without a radical shift in how cities are built and managed, the 'new normal' of record-breaking summers will continue to disproportionately affect low-income residents who cannot afford air conditioning or live in poorly ventilated housing.
Furthermore, the reliance on repeated heat alerts risks 'alert fatigue,' where the public becomes desensitized to the warnings. If the government continues to treat these events as isolated weather anomalies rather than symptoms of a permanent climate shift, the public-interest stakes will only rise. The focus must move beyond temporary warnings toward a long-term strategy that addresses the built environment's inability to cope with the heat, ensuring that cities remain habitable for all citizens, not just those with the means to escape the heat.
